E³ supports the DBE to host inaugural entrepreneurship education policy dialogue

9-11 June 2025 | Birchwood Hotel and Conference Centre

 

The Department of Basic Education, in partnership with the European Union’s Education for Employability Programme, successfully convened the first-ever national Policy Dialogue on Entrepreneurship Education. This groundbreaking three-day event brought together over 250 diverse stakeholders including government officials, educators, youth representatives, civil society, and private sector partners.

 

The dialogue focused on co-creating a national entrepreneurship education policy framework, addressing the urgent need to equip South African youth with entrepreneurial mindsets and skills for a rapidly changing world. Minister Siviwe Gwarube opened the event, emphasizing that “entrepreneurship is not just a privilege of the few, but the possibility of the many.”

 

Key insights emerged around embedding entrepreneurship across all subjects and grades, supporting teacher development, ensuring youth voice in policy-making, and building systematic alignment across government departments. The event featured innovative generative dialogue methodology, youth panels, and interactive sessions exploring the knowledge, values, skills, and cross-cutting priorities essential to entrepreneurial education.
